When's the best time to book a family-friendly holiday in Orland Park?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 22ยฐC,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-1ยฐC. Average annual precipitation for Orland Park is 1181 mm.
What's there to see and do with your family in Orland Park?
Orland Square, Orland Park Sportsplex and Centennial Park Aquatic Center are interesting attractions that you and your family will enjoy exploring while you are staying in Orland Park. Make sure that you have lots of time for activities such as Gaelic Park and Chicago Ridge Shopping Mall.
What's the best way for us to get around Orland Park?
If you'd like to explore more of the area, take a train from Orland Park 143rd Street Station, Orland Park 153rd Street Station or Orland Park 179th Street Station. Orland Park might not have many public transport options to choose from, so consider renting a car to explore more.
